June 22, 2013 — Kenosha County

Hawthorn Hollow Nature Conservancy - Green Bay Road close to the Kenosha border with Racine. The Pike River runs through the property which is where I find the Jewel Wings each year.

Common Whitetail (Plathemis lydia)
Photographed
Up to 5 or so Common Whitetails in a small garden area close to the river. (1 photo)
Ebony Jewelwing (Calopteryx maculata)
Photographed
Maybe 30 or so Jewelwings in shrubbery along the river and in the small flower garden close by. (3 photos)
Eastern Forktail (Ischnura verticalis)
Photographed
This was perched on a peony in the flower garden at the same location. (ID adjusted from Southern spreadwing by D. Jackson) (1 photo)
